Explain the advantage in having an inducible enzyme system that is regulated

 <span>It has the advantage that only when the substrate is presence the genes responsible for its metabolism are turned on.</span>

Which data from ocean rocks showed seafloor spreading and convinced scientists the theory of plate tectonics was valid? A. densi
Norma-Jean [14]
I believe that paleomagnetism was a key to determining that the seafloors were spreading since the paleomagnetism changes at certain geological intervals so that stripes of new rock with the youngest paleomagnetism would be right at the mid-ocean trenches and successively would be older the further they are from the trench, ie on either side of it, symmetrically.
